Dora Arce Valentín, the World Communion of Reformed Churches’ executive secretary for justice and partnership, will join a delegation from the Presbyterian Church (U.S.A.) that will advocate for gender equity with the 58th United Nations Commission on the Status of Women. This Commission is a functional commission of the Economic and Social Council of the United Nations and is the principal global policy-making body dedicated exclusively to gender equality and advancement of women. Arce Valentín will serve on a panel for the side event Millennium Development Goals: Reflections from Reformed Churches on Thursday, March 13, 2014 at 10:30 AM at the Salvation Army Auditorium, 221 East 52nd Street. The side event is organized in partnership with the Presbyterian Church (U.S.A.) and Presbyterian Women.
